Admission Requirements

Academic Requirements

You need the following GPA score:

Required score: 3

Applicants for graduate programs must have the equivalent of a bachelor\xe2\x80\x99s degree with a minimum GPA equivalent to 3 on a US 4.0 grading scale. Admitted applicants typically have an undergraduate GPA of or better on a 4.0 scale. No exam grade should be lower than 4.5 (European grade scale) or D (American grade scale).

Your GPA (Grade Point Average) is calculated using the grades that you received in each course, and is determined by the points assigned to each grade (e.g. for the US grading scale from A-F).

  • A 3.0 GPA or higher in a Bachelor\'s degree in any field is highly recommended. Students require a general knowledge of the intellectual, social and cultural history of East Asia.
Two years of a university-level Asian language is required for the degree. These two years of language study may be satisfied before enrollment in the graduate program, or during enrollment in the master\'s program.
  • Statement of Purpose

English Proficiency: IELTS 7 or equivalent.
